Rex Todhunter Stout (1886–1975) was an American crime writer, best known as the creator of the larger-than-life fictional detective Nero Wolfe, described by reviewer Will Cuppy as "that Falstaff of detectives." Wolfe's assistant Archie Goodwin recorded the cases of the detective genius from 1934 (Fer-de-Lance) to 1975 (A Family Affair).

The Nero Wolfe corpus was nominated Best Mystery Series of the Century at Bouchercon 2000, the world's largest mystery convention, and Rex Stout was nominated Best Mystery Writer of the Century.

Christmas reading in July? Guilty!

This should not be your first Nero Wolfe read. There is too much in this one that “ticks the boxes” for Wolfe fans. And, there are plenty of jokes and expectations that can only be appreciated by those who have followed this detective for a while.

The book starts out with Archie Goodwin (Wolfe’s “cat’s paw”), declining to take Wolfe on a rare excursion from his NYC brownstone to meet with another orchid fancier. Fast on the heels of that major incident, Archie informs his boss that he has obtained a license for himself to be married to one of the chief employees of a former client. Only with some prior experience can the reader really imagine the effect of this on Wolfe.

The actions, reactions and surprises, come fast and furious for a while (like a body tumbling down a spiral staircase). The relationship between Wolfe and Goodwin goes through some interesting and tense developments. Stout has some fun with the storyline and the reveal.

In the end, as Wolfe might put it, “the result was satisfactory.”

PS: Caution: the way people of Asian origin are talked about is no longer acceptable

COUNTDOWN: Mid-20th Century North American Crime
BOOK/Novella 156 (of 250)
I no longer attend Christmas parties as they are just too dangerous, as exemplified here. Instead, I often celebrate St. Patrick's Day: this year 93 times. It's been a good year, 2018.
HOOK - 3 stars: "I'm sorry sir," I [Archie] tried to sound sorry. "But I told you [Nero] two days ago, Monday, that I had a date for Friday afternoon..." Nero shook his head, "That won't do." This opening argument between Archie and Nero is typical, as they are on a collision course as to arrangements.
PACE - 3: Solid novella building to a nice finish.
PLOT - 4: Archie presents to Nero his (Archie's) marriage certificate to a Margot Dickey and says he [Archie] absolutely must attend the engagement party. Nero's response is classic Stout: "You are deranged," Nero says to his live-in sidekick. Nero's plans are of course far more important, as he is to meet Mr. Thompson, "the best [orchid] hybridizer in England" only in town for a few hours. Nero hires a limo, Archie goes to his party, and Santa Claus as a bartender serves a poisoned drink to a guest. The guest dies and Santa disappears. Then the twist and turns kick in and Nero's solution is a beauty.
CHARACTERS - 4: Nero and Archie are at their best/worst. Archie plans to have his bride live with them in Nero's fabulous brownstone but Nero is "allergic" to women in general. Fritz, their cook, is so upset "he forgot to put lemon juice in the souffle!" Plus there is Santa Claus, the bride-to-be, and a dead character.
ATMOSPHERE - 2: A missed opportunity, as all we get is "New York might get an off-white Christmas".
SUMMARY - 3.2. Santa and a dead body. Yep, I've given up on Christmas parties.

Wolfe and Archie are talking. Archie springs his engagement on Wolfe and heads to a Christmas Party. At the Christmas Party, the Executive is poisoned! The bartender is dressed as Santa Claus and leaves during the excitement. The police are called and prioritize finding Santa first. Wolfe confesses to Archie that he was the Santa Claus bartender.

He wants to avoid confessing that he was Santa to the police. This is made harder when one of the attendees meets with Archie and Wolfe to let them know that she knows that Wolfe was the Santa as well as that the deceased was going to be with her. She throws suspicion on Archie's "fiancée".

Archie is called to talk with the police and Wolfe plans to catch the actual murderer.

He succeeds and the murderer is turned over to the police.
